Splash Mountain Ride Photos & Video

Splash Mountain is one of our favorite attractions at Walt Disney World. Splash Mountain is a log flume attraction that is based loosely on the controversial animated film Song of the South. It shares common characters and the overarching story is similar. The attraction tells the story of the mischievous Br’er Rabbit, as he leaves